Yep, that's the one. I was thinking of keeping the B&K as a stereo amp and putting the extra 2 channels as "Class A" into another chassis with more heat sink area. My question was will the Toshiba output Fets work? Or another design, as matched J74 are hard to find?
try finding appropriate schematic using 2SJ49/50 and 2SK134/135 and build any of those with your mosfets
for common type FW amp, regular IRFP mosfets are better choice - more power, greater xconductance
and - do not count to have more than 25W of dissipation per device (of yours) with proper heatsinking - those are "just" 100W devices with somewhat smaller case
